Mustard-Mascarpone Bruschetta

Fabio Trabocchi, Fiola, Washington, D.C.: "Dijon adds the right amount of spice to rich mascarpone in this easy spread."

Recipe information

  • Yield

    Makes 3/4 cup

Ingredients

1/2 cup mascarpone
1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
3 tablespoons Dijon mustard
salt
pepper

Preparation

  1. Whisk 1/2 cup mascarpone, 1/4 cup chopped fresh basil, and 3 tablespoons Dijon mustard in a medium bowl.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Spread on crusty bread.
